Solution Overview

Problem

Standard cover shooter controls in action video games require players to remember multiple buttons for managing cover and firing states, leading to complexity and player errors, such as unnecessary exposure to enemies due to forgotten button interactions.

Innovation Solution

Simplified shooter controls that eliminate the need for a dedicated cover button by using the fire button to transition between covered and weapon-ready states, where releasing the screen automatically returns the character to the covered state when not aiming or firing.

Data Source

PatentUS10183222B2Systems and methods for triggering action character cover in a video game
Publication Date: 2019.01.22 ELECTRONIC ARTS INC

AI summary

Systems and methods are provided in which a character possessing a weapon is displayed in a scene along with first and second affordances. Responsive to first affordance user contact, scene orientation is changed. Responsive to second affordance user contact with a first status of the weapon, a firing process is performed in which the weapon is fired and the weapon status is updated. When (i) the first and second affordances are user contact free or (ii) the second affordance is presently in user contact and there is a second weapon status, firing is terminated. Alternatively, when the second affordance is presently in user contact and there is a first weapon status, the firing is repeated. Alternatively still, with (i) present first affordance user contact, (ii) a first weapon status, and (iii) no present second affordance user contact, the firing is repeated upon second affordance user contact.
